Linda Marie Vigesaa – Obit

Linda Marie Vigesaa, 75, died peacefully in her cozy little home in Twin Valley, MN, on Thursday, February 11, 2021, with her daughter Kim and special friend Denise by her side and under the care of Hospice of the Red River Valley.

Linda grew up in Twin Valley and was the daughter to Hilda (Prestegord) Grove and stepfather, Gerald Grove. Linda attended school in Twin Valley. She then moved to Fargo and was a waitress for a short time. She met Larry Vigesaa and they were united in marriage on March 30, 1964.

Larry and Linda adopted Kimberly Marie in 1971. Linda loved telling the story of picking her up off the plane in Minneapolis. From that point on Kim was the light of their lives. Larry owned a construction business that later brought them from living in Twin Valley to spending some time in Alaska. After moving back to Twin Valley, you could often find Linda cooking wonderful meals, canning delicious pickles, and raising batches of poodles. Linda had worked for the ACI Tech Center and for Chuck Gunnerson at Ada Produce. After retiring, she was content on staying home and often had visitors sitting in her yard just enjoying her kind heart and sweet giggle. Anyone who knew her would agree that a visit with Linda was always good for the soul. Music was always playing and usually, people honked as they drove by just to say hello to the wonderful woman she was.

Sister time, looking fancy, Walmart trips, the casino, old country songs, porcelain dolls, Opdahl Donuts, and Kim’s baked goodies were all of her favorite things. May the gentle love and memories of Linda be a favorite place in our hearts forevermore.

Linda is survived by her daughter Kim, of Twin Valley, MN; sister, Geri (Bruce) Bueng, Valley City, ND; sister-in-law, Kathy (Dan) Bredman, Ada, MN; and brothers-in-law, Butch Johnson and Ray Myers, both of Ada, MN; and several nieces and nephews, cousins, and many friends that are just like family. She was preceded in death by her mother, Hilda; stepfather, Gerald; and sisters, Eleanor (Raymond) Myers, and Susie (Butch) Johnson.

Blessed be the memory of our dear Linda Marie.

A gathering of family and friends to celebrate Linda’s life will take place at Fredrikson-Ganje Funeral Home in Ada on Thursday, February 18, 2021, from 5:00 – 7:00 PM, with a 6:30 PM prayer service.
